Jeļena Ostapenko defeated Simona Halep in the final, 4–6, 6–4, 6–3 to win the women's singles tennis title at the 2017 French Open.[1] [2] This was Ostapenko's first WTA Tour-level singles title. She became the first Latvian player, male or female, to win a Grand Slam singles tournament, the youngest woman to win the French Open since 1997 [3] and the first woman since Barbara Jordan at the 1979 Australian Open to win a Grand Slam as her first tour-level singles title.[4] Ostapenko was the first unseeded woman to win a Grand Slam since Kim Clijsters in the 2009 US Open . She was also the first unseeded woman to reach the French Open final since Mima Jaušovec in 1983 , the first unseeded woman to win the French Open since Margaret Scriven in 1933 , and as well as the lowest-ranked (47) since computer rankings began in 1975 .[5] [6]
Garbiñe Muguruza was the defending champion but was defeated in the fourth round by Kristina Mladenovic .[7]
It was the first time at the French Open since 1977 , and any Grand Slam since the 1979 Australian Open that no former Grand Slam champion reached the quarterfinals.[8]
As a result of Halep's loss in the final, Angelique Kerber retained the WTA No. 1 singles ranking even though she lost in the first round. Kerber's loss marked the first time the top women's seed had lost her first-round match at the French Open in the Open Era , and the first time this had happened at any Grand Slam tournament since the 2001 Wimbledon Championships .[9] [10]
This was the first French Open since 2011 to feature neither Maria Sharapova nor Serena Williams in the final. This was the first Grand Slam tournament to feature neither player since the 2002 Australian Open . Serena was not there due to pregnancy and Maria had been temporarily banned for doping.
